What is the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program?

The Indigo Cadet Pilot Program is a specialized training program designed by IndiGo to develop future pilots who will join the airline's fleet. The program is tailored for young individuals who aspire to become commercial pilots but have limited experience in aviation. By partnering with global flight schools and providing structured training, the program helps cadets earn their Commercial Pilot License (CPL), followed by a guaranteed position as a First Officer with IndiGo.

Unlike traditional pilot training paths, the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program offers a comprehensive and streamlined route to becoming a pilot, with the added benefit of job security upon successful completion of the program. Through partnerships with leading flight schools such as CAE, L3 Harris, Skyborne, and more, cadets receive high-quality training, which makes them highly competitive in the aviation industry.

Stages of the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program

The Indigo Cadet Pilot Program is divided into several stages to ensure that cadets receive a well-rounded education. These stages combine both theoretical classroom training and practical flight experience, preparing cadets to be skilled, competent pilots. Here’s a breakdown of the stages involved in the program:

1. Ground School Training

The first stage of the program is ground school training, where cadets learn the theoretical aspects of aviation. During this phase, they study subjects such as:

  • Aerodynamics
  • Aircraft systems and operations
  • Aviation regulations and laws
  • Meteorology
  • Navigation and flight planning
  • Air traffic control (ATC) communication

Ground school training provides cadets with the knowledge needed to operate aircraft safely and efficiently, setting the foundation for their flight training. It is an essential part of the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program, as it prepares cadets for the more practical aspects of flying.

2. Flight Training

Once cadets complete their ground school training, they move on to the flight training phase. This is where cadets gain hands-on experience in the cockpit, flying real aircraft under the supervision of experienced instructors. During this stage, cadets will learn how to:

  • Perform basic flight maneuvers
  • Navigate using instruments and GPS
  • Handle emergency situations
  • Understand flight dynamics and handling characteristics
  • Conduct flight checks and assessments

Flight training is conducted at partnered flight schools, such as L3 Harris and CAE, ensuring that cadets receive the highest standard of instruction and resources. The practical flight training phase is an essential part of the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program, as it allows cadets to gain real-world experience in a controlled environment.

3. Simulator Training

In addition to flight training, cadets will also undergo simulator training. This allows them to practice complex flight scenarios, such as adverse weather conditions, engine failures, and emergency landings, without the risk involved in real-world flying. Flight simulators replicate the cockpit environment of an actual aircraft, providing cadets with a realistic experience that prepares them for any situation that may arise during a commercial flight.

Simulator training is crucial to building the skills and confidence needed to handle high-pressure situations in the air. Cadets enrolled in the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program will have access to state-of-the-art simulators to help them sharpen their flying skills.

4. Type Rating Training

After cadets have completed their initial flight training and gained sufficient flying experience, they will undergo type rating training. This specialized training is specific to the type of aircraft they will be flying with IndiGo, such as the Airbus A320. Type rating training focuses on:

  • The operation of specific aircraft systems
  • The characteristics and performance of the aircraft
  • Handling the aircraft in various flight conditions
  • Preparing for line operations with the airline

Type rating training is essential for cadets to transition from flight training to actual airline operations. Once completed, cadets are ready to take on the role of a First Officer with IndiGo.

Medical Requirements for the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program

One of the most important requirements for joining the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program is passing the medical examination. To become a commercial pilot, candidates must meet the medical standards set by the Directorate General of Civil Aviation (DGCA) in India.

Class 1 Medical Certificate

Aspiring pilots must obtain a Class 1 Medical Certificate, which is the highest medical standard required for commercial pilots. The medical examination includes several tests to ensure that the candidate is physically and mentally fit to handle the demanding role of a pilot. The main medical requirements for the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program include:

  • Vision: Candidates must have 6/6 vision in both eyes, with or without correction. Color blindness is not permitted for pilots.
  • Hearing: Pilots must have normal hearing, allowing them to hear communication clearly during flight.
  • General Health: The candidate must undergo a thorough medical examination to check for any underlying health conditions, such as cardiovascular issues or neurological disorders.
  • Mental Health: Mental fitness is crucial for pilots. Candidates must be free from mental health conditions that could impair their ability to operate an aircraft safely.
  • Height and Weight: There are specific height and weight requirements for pilots, ensuring that they can comfortably fit in the cockpit and handle the physical demands of flying.

Passing the Class 1 Medical Certificate exam is a critical step in the selection process for the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program. Only candidates who meet these medical standards will be eligible to proceed with the training.

Psychometric Tests in the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program

As part of the selection process, candidates for the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program must also undergo psychometric testing. These tests are designed to assess a candidate’s cognitive abilities, personality traits, and behavioral patterns. Psychometric tests are an important part of pilot selection, as they help to determine whether an individual has the mental fortitude, decision-making skills, and emotional stability needed to succeed in high-pressure situations.

The psychometric tests typically include:

  • Cognitive Ability Tests: These tests assess logical reasoning, problem-solving skills, and the ability to think quickly in complex situations.
  • Personality Assessments: These tests evaluate how well candidates handle stress, communicate, and work as part of a team.
  • Situational Judgment Tests: These tests simulate real-world scenarios that a pilot might encounter, such as managing an emergency situation or making decisions under pressure.

Psychometric testing ensures that only the most mentally and emotionally resilient candidates are selected for the Indigo Cadet Pilot Program. It is an important tool for determining whether a candidate has the right psychological profile to become a successful pilot.
